Background notes

Archive material and source history

Lee Fields started singing in the 1970s, drawing from the raw energy of James Brown and Otis Redding. He moved to New York City around that time, where he worked on his voice and stage presence for years before things really clicked. In 1992, he met bassist Kevin Banks and drummer Thomas Brenneck, which became the foundation for what would eventually be called Lee Fields & The Expressions.

Their 2009 album 'My World' was the record that brought them wider attention. It had a tight, soulful sound that felt both classic and immediate. They followed it with albums like 'Special Night' in 2012 and 'It Rains Love' in 2019. Songs like 'I Still Got It' and 'Eye To Eye' show Fields' weathered, powerful delivery over the band's steady grooves.

Fields was born in Wilmington, North Carolina in 1954. As a teenager, he had a band called the Fabulous Five. The music he makes now feels less like a revival and more like a continuation of something he's been doing his whole life.
